BRUN PEREIRA, Martina. he Legal Protection of the Human Right to a Healthy Environment in Uruguay. Rev. Derecho [online]. 2021, n.23, pp.116-141.  Epub June 10, 2021. ISSN 1510-3714.  https://doi.org/10.22235/rd23.2517.

The purpose of this article is to analyze the legal protection of the right to the environment in Uruguay to observe whether this system responds to the regulations and standards developed in the regional system. To this end, it analyzes national jurisprudence together with various parliamentary proceedings that led to the approval of norms concerning the protection of the right. The article reflects, in short, on the treatment of the right to the environment in Uruguay, in addition to considering some aspects of jurisdiction that represent the current challenges of this right. Among the conclusions it is highlighted that the regional standards constitute interpretative guidelines that encourage countries like Uruguay to adopt more effective legal attitudes for the protection of the environment, and that, in spite of the wide support that the domestic law has, it has not been applied in a significant manner in the country.

Keywords : environmental rights; judicial protection; regional system; Uruguayan Nacional System; human rights.
